| Alzheimer's 'not always linked to memory loss symptoms' |
| Washington, may 17 ANI: Half of people who develop Alzheimer's disease before the age of 60 are initially misdiagnosed as having other kinds of brain disease when they do not have memory problems, according to a new study read more |

| Now, a 33-in-1 golf club that can be adjusted to mimic a bag of woods and irons! |
| London, May 18 ANI: Inventors are swearing on it as the only golf club you will ever need. The 33-In-1 Golf Club allows golfers to choose from five putters, two drivers, three fairway woods, 14 irons, or nine wedges - all at the turn of a dial read more |
